The 4A's You Need to Have for a Successful Marriage

Greg & Cheryl Clarke launches a new book for couples called "The Power of the 4A's," discussing how they went from contemplating divorce to a thriving, successful marriage.

NEW YORK - Washingtoner -- Marriage Specialists Greg & Cheryl Clarke releases their first book The Power of the 4A's: How We Went From Contemplating Divorce To A Successful Thriving Marriage. Couples will discover how to transform their relationship from hurting to healed using these four A's: Acceptance, Appreciation, Affection, and Agreement. It includes hands-on exercises and practical knowledge. The 4A's method teaches how to build and cultivate a thriving and intimate relationship with their spouse. Greg and Cheryl Clarke are a husband-and-wife team. Better known as "the Marriage Specialists", they share the same passion for helping couples build stronger, healthier marriages, taking them from HURTING to HEALED. Greg and Cheryl are speakers, mentors, ministers, and relationship/business coaches. They use their transcendent coaching programs to offer foundational tools and uncommon. Greg is an early childhood education teacher, ordained minister, and certified relationship/life coach. Cheryl is a licensed marriage and family therapist, ordained minister, and motivational speaker.

After being together for more than 30 years, with six beautiful children, the Clarkes have a wealth of wisdom to share. Through God's promise and spiritual interventions, Greg and Cheryl Clarke are on a mission to be role models, proving that marriages can LAST with the right tools.
